Problems I am having as of now

 Having spent eight months learning the piano, these are some of the problems I have encountered as a 38-year old beginner.


  • Sometimes my mind switches off and I can't play a piece which I have played every day for the last few months. However hard I try, my fingers do not land on the correct keys. At that point of time, if I try to read the notation, my mind looks at the notation as if it is completely new and I am learning the piece for the first time. I have to calculate what the note is by doing the FACE/ EGBDF/ ACEG/GBDFA calculation. After a while, maybe a few minutes, or maybe the next day, I can again play the piece as I played it for the last few months.
  • With my left hand, when I use fingers 3 and 1, and am not using finger 2, my finger 2 does not lie low on the keys. It is slightly raised. My teacher says it looks bad and keeps requesting me to lower the finger.
  • When I am playing the piano, my mind often keeps wandering and all unnecessary junk thoughts enter my mind. Sometimes, these thoughts make me play the wrong notes. Then I have to force myself to rid my mind of these thoughts and focus and play the correct notes.
